JUST IN: Fubara Swears In Caretaker Chairmen For 23 LGs

—

Rivers state Governor Siminalayi Fubara, on Wednesday 19th June, swore in new caretaker chairmen for the 23 local government areas of the state.

Fubara inaugurated the new caretaker chairmen hours after the House of Assembly, led by factional Speaker, Victor Jumbo, screened and confirmed the nominees.

The News Chronicle recalls that Governor Fubara had sent the list to the state House of Assembly on Tuesday and the nominees were invited for screening as early as 8 am on Wednesday, according to a statement made available by the Clerk of the House, G.M. Gillis-West.

The nomination came amid a worsening political crisis in the state, as former council chairmen have refused to vacate their offices after their tenure expired.

It was reported that the swearing-in took place at the Executive Council Chambers of the Government House in Port Harcourt, the state capital, amid tight security.
It was also gathered that the first batch of eleven caretaker chairmen took their oath of office before other batches came in to equally take their oath.
